I haven't actually turned off my laptop in some time (only hibernated). I took my laptop to a friend's and hibernated it before I left, turned it on over there, but then closed the lid. The laptop went into sleep mode and I pressed the spacebar to turn it back on, but it just went to a black screen. I held the power button to turn it off and back on, but it just goes to the "Asus gaming series" screen and does nothing.
The front power button shows a different, colorful Asus logo, but that screen also does nothing (Except you can press ctrl+alt+del on both screens to restart).
Pressing the top power button goes to that "Asus gaming series" logo, and I can press Esc or F2 to get to the American Megatrends BIOS screen (as if it's going into setup or going into the boot selection menu) but it never does that either.
What I've currently tried:
* Removing and reseating the RAM and HDD
* Removing the battery and AC cord and holding the power buttons for 45secs
* Pressing the little >o< button on the bottom for about 30 secs with the AC cord in, and with it out
* Trying each stick of RAM separately
* Reflashing the BIOS (but I couldn't because it wouldn't enter the flash utility [F4 I believe])
* Nothing was in any USB port, except for a flash drive when I was trying the BIOS flash
* Booting a few different discs (couldn't even get to screen to choose where to boot from)
